Understanding Testosterone Propionate 100 Dosage

Testosterone Propionate 100 is a popular anabolic steroid known for its rapid onset of action and short half-life. It is often favored by athletes and bodybuilders for its ability to enhance performance and promote muscle growth in a relatively short period. However, understanding the appropriate dosage is crucial to maximizing its benefits while minimizing potential side effects.

Monitoring and Side Effects

While using Testosterone Propionate, monitoring for side effects is essential. Common side effects can include:

  • Acne
  • Hair loss
  • Increased aggression
  • Gynecomastia

It is recommended to consult with a healthcare professional before starting any anabolic steroid regimen to ensure safe usage.
